{"product_id":"personalising-public-services-understanding-the-personalisation-narrative-9781847427601","title":"Personalising public services: Understanding the","description":"\u003cb\u003eBook Synopsis\u003c\/b\u003e\u003cbr\u003ePersonalisation - the idea that public services should be tailored to the individual, with budgets devolved to the service user or frontline staff - is increasingly seen as the future of the welfare state. This book focuses on how personalisation evolved as a policy narrative and has mobilised such wide-ranging political support.
